Artist helps children with cancer

TEENAGERS with cancer are set to benefit from a print by artist Tom Harland

Mr Harland, who is staging his annual Christmas exhibition at his gallery in Low Street, North Ferriby, is raising money for the Teenage Cancer Trust. All the proceeds from the raffle – whose prize is a limited edition print Above the Rooftops - Robin Hood's Bay – are going to the charity.

Mr Harland, who is pictured in front of the largest work in the show, a 6ft by 4ft acryclic of the entrance to Whitby Harbour, entitled The Rough and the Smooth, said: "This is the third time we have been involved in raising money for the Teenage Cancer Trust. I am very fortunate that none of my children have had problems in that way but I just think it is a very deserving cause." For opening times visit www.tomharland.com.
